Udostępnij przez


Ogólne błędy MCI

Następujące wartości błędów mogą być zwracane przez funkcję mciSendCommand lub mciSendString:

Wartość Znaczenie
MCIERR_BAD_TIME_FORMAT Określona wartość formatu czasu jest nieprawidłowa.
MCIERR_CANNOT_LOAD_DRIVER Określony sterownik urządzenia nie zostanie poprawnie załadowany.
MCIERR_CANNOT_USE_ALL Nazwa urządzenia "all" nie jest dozwolona dla tego polecenia.
MCIERR_CREATEWINDOW Nie można utworzyć ani użyć okna.
MCIERR_DEVICE_LENGTH Nazwa urządzenia lub sterownika jest za długa. Określ nazwę urządzenia lub sterownika, która jest mniejsza niż 79 znaków.
MCIERR_DEVICE_LOCKED Urządzenie jest teraz zamykane. Poczekaj kilka sekund, a następnie spróbuj ponownie.
MCIERR_DEVICE_NOT_INSTALLED Określone urządzenie nie jest zainstalowane w systemie. Użyj opcji Sterowniki z Panelu sterowania, aby zainstalować urządzenie.
MCIERR_DEVICE_NOT_READY Sterownik urządzenia nie jest gotowy.
MCIERR_DEVICE_OPEN Nazwa urządzenia jest już używana jako alias przez tę aplikację. Użyj unikatowego aliasu.
MCIERR_DEVICE_ORD_LENGTH Nazwa urządzenia lub sterownika jest za długa. Określ nazwę urządzenia lub sterownika, która jest mniejsza niż 79 znaków.
MCIERR_DEVICE_TYPE_REQUIRED Nie można odnaleźć określonego urządzenia w systemie. Sprawdź, czy urządzenie jest zainstalowane, a nazwa urządzenia jest poprawna.
MCIERR_DRIVER Sterownik urządzenia wykazuje problem. Zapoznaj się z producentem urządzenia w celu uzyskania nowego sterownika.
MCIERR_DRIVER_INTERNAL Sterownik urządzenia wykazuje problem. Zapoznaj się z producentem urządzenia w celu uzyskania nowego sterownika.
MCIERR_DUPLICATE_ALIAS Określony alias jest już używany w tej aplikacji. Użyj unikatowego aliasu.
MCIERR_EXTENSION_NOT_FOUND Określone rozszerzenie nie ma skojarzonego z nim typu urządzenia. Określ typ urządzenia.
MCIERR_EXTRA_CHARACTERS Należy ująć ciąg z cudzysłowami; znaki następujące po znaku cudzysłowu zamykającego są nieprawidłowe.
MCIERR_FILE_NOT_FOUND Nie można odnaleźć żądanego pliku. Sprawdź, czy ścieżka i nazwa pliku są poprawne.
MCIERR_FILE_NOT_SAVED Plik nie został zapisany. Upewnij się, że system ma wystarczającą ilość miejsca na dysku lub ma nienaruszone połączenie sieciowe.
MCIERR_FILE_READ Odczyt z pliku nie powiódł się. Upewnij się, że plik jest obecny w systemie lub że system ma nienaruszone połączenie sieciowe.
MCIERR_FILE_WRITE Zapisywanie w pliku nie powiodło się. Upewnij się, że system ma wystarczającą ilość miejsca na dysku lub ma nienaruszone połączenie sieciowe.
MCIERR_FILENAME_REQUIRED Nazwa pliku jest nieprawidłowa. Upewnij się, że nazwa pliku nie jest dłuższa niż osiem znaków, po którym następuje kropka i rozszerzenie.
MCIERR_FLAGS_NOT_COMPATIBLE Nie można używać razem określonych parametrów.
MCIERR_GET_CD Nie można odnaleźć żądanego pliku LUB urządzenia MCI. Spróbuj zmienić katalogi lub ponownie uruchomić system.
MCIERR_HARDWARE Określone urządzenie wykazuje problem. Sprawdź, czy urządzenie działa poprawnie lub skontaktuj się z producentem urządzenia.
MCIERR_ILLEGAL_FOR_AUTO_OPEN McI nie wykona określonego polecenia na automatycznie otwartym urządzeniu. Poczekaj na zamknięcie urządzenia, a następnie spróbuj wykonać polecenie .
MCIERR_INTERNAL Wystąpił problem podczas inicjowania interfejsu MCI. Spróbuj ponownie uruchomić system operacyjny Windows.
MCIERR_INVALID_DEVICE_ID Nieprawidłowy identyfikator urządzenia. Użyj identyfikatora podanego dla urządzenia, gdy urządzenie zostało otwarte.
MCIERR_INVALID_DEVICE_NAME Określone urządzenie nie jest otwarte ani rozpoznawane przez MCI.
MCIERR_INVALID_FILE Nie można odtworzyć określonego pliku na określonym urządzeniu MCI. Plik może być uszkodzony lub może używać niepoprawnego formatu pliku.
MCIERR_MISSING_PARAMETER Określone polecenie wymaga parametru, który należy podać.
MCIERR_MULTIPLE Wystąpiły błędy na więcej niż jednym urządzeniu. Określ każde polecenie i urządzenie oddzielnie, aby zidentyfikować urządzenia powodujące błędy.
MCIERR_MUST_USE_SHAREABLE Sterownik urządzenia jest już używany. Należy określić parametr "sharable" z każdym otwartym poleceniem, aby udostępnić urządzenie.
MCIERR_NO_ELEMENT_ALLOWED Określone urządzenie nie używa nazwy pliku.
MCIERR_NO_INTEGER Parametr dla tego polecenia MCI musi być wartością całkowitą.
MCIERR_NO_WINDOW Brak okna wyświetlania.
MCIERR_NONAPPLICABLE_FUNCTION Nie można wykonać określonej sekwencji poleceń MCI w podanej kolejności. Popraw sekwencję poleceń; następnie spróbuj ponownie.
MCIERR_NULL_PARAMETER_BLOCK Blok parametrów o wartości null (struktura) został przekazany do interfejsu MCI.
MCIERR_OUT_OF_MEMORY System nie ma wystarczającej ilości pamięci dla tego zadania. Zamknij co najmniej jedną aplikację, aby zwiększyć ilość dostępnej pamięci, a następnie spróbuj ponownie wykonać zadanie.
MCIERR_OUTOFRANGE Określona wartość parametru jest poza zakresem dla określonego polecenia MCI.
MCIERR_SET_CD Określony plik lub urządzenie MCI jest niedostępne, ponieważ aplikacja nie może zmienić katalogów.
MCIERR_SET_DRIVE Określony plik lub urządzenie MCI jest niedostępne, ponieważ aplikacja nie może zmienić dysków.
MCIERR_UNNAMED_RESOURCE Nie można przechowywać pliku bez nazwy. Określ nazwę pliku.
MCIERR_UNRECOGNIZED_COMMAND Sterownik nie może rozpoznać określonego polecenia.
MCIERR_UNSUPPORTED_FUNCTION Sterownik urządzenia MCI używany przez system nie obsługuje określonego polecenia.